探秘乌伊岭H5小程序高级研发的技术之路

作者:乌兰察布麻将开发公司 阅读:20 次 发布时间:2023-07-22 14:42:17

摘要:乌伊岭H5小程序是一款致力于为用户提供高效、便捷服务的智能小程序。该小程序的研发过程中,需要掌握多种技术、运用不同的开发框架,不断优化其功能和用户体验。本文将围绕乌伊岭H5小程序的研发经验进行探秘,介绍其高级研发技术之路。1. 初创团队的技术堆栈选择在乌伊岭H5小程序创立的初期,团队面对...

  乌伊岭H5小程序是一款致力于为用户提供高效、便捷服务的智能小程序。该小程序的研发过程中,需要掌握多种技术、运用不同的开发框架,不断优化其功能和用户体验。本文将围绕乌伊岭H5小程序的研发经验进行探秘,介绍其高级研发技术之路。

探秘乌伊岭H5小程序高级研发的技术之路

  1. 初创团队的技术堆栈选择

  在乌伊岭H5小程序创立的初期,团队面对的第一个问题是技术堆栈选择。在市场上,常用的开发框架包括React、Vue、Angular等。经过团队的讨论和实践,最终选择使用Vue框架。Vue和React一样,都是非常流行的前端框架,在开发的便捷性和性能方面都非常优秀。而在Vue框架的使用上,它很遵循“自下而上”的开发模式,可以逐渐完善项目。

  2. 多端开发以及组件化思想

  在H5小程序的开发中,如何保持多端兼容、提高代码复用率,是非常关键的。Vue框架提供的多端开发和组件化思想,为我们解决这些问题提供了不少帮助。在组件化思想上,我们将重复利用的组件进行封装,完成了代码的复用;而多端开发上,我们利用了Vue提供的插件,实现了小程序和网页在不同端渲染的效果。

  3. 跨域方案及数据交互方法

  在小程序的开发过程中,往往会面临着跨域等诸多问题。而在乌伊岭H5小程序中,我们借助了一个ProxyTable的插件,通过该插件转发请求和处理跨域问题,最终实现了H5小程序正常访问。同时在数据交互上,我们选用了类似于“观察者”的设计模式,将访问数据的代码进行封装,从而实现了页面与数据的分离。

  4. 分层式的路由管理

  大型的小程序一般都有很多复杂的路由,低效的管理和部署将极大的影响开发效率,使项目变得松散、难以控制。在我们的乌伊岭H5小程序中,我们采用了分层式的路由管理模式,将路由按照不同的层次进行管理,减少了冲突,增强了可读性和可扩展性。

  5. 微信小程序API的优化

  微信小程序作为近几年新出现的前端开发技术,虽然还不如React和Vue等框架流行,但是却是目前最成熟、最有前途的小程序框架。在H5小程序的开发中,我们对微信小程序API进行针对性的优化,采用极简开发模式,弱化API细节,引入更简单易用的外部模块,提高H5小程序的开发效率。

  结尾语:在这篇文章中,我们回顾了乌伊岭H5小程序研发的技术之路。从初创团队技术堆栈的选择,到多端开发和组件化思想、跨域方案及数据交互方法、分层式的路由管理等多方面的优化,我们深刻地认识到,在H5小程序的开发中,技术的进步直接决定了产品的发展。

  本文将深入探讨乌伊岭H5小程序的高级研发技术之路。从技术架构、运行环境、调试与测试、性能优化等方面,全面分析乌伊岭H5小程序的技术实现过程。读者可以从中获得一些有价值的技术参考和实践经验。

  1. 乌伊岭H5小程序的技术架构

  乌伊岭是一个集休闲、旅游、观光、娱乐、购物等功能于一体的综合性旅游目的地。乌伊岭H5小程序的开发,采用了MVC(Model-View-Controller)模式,将应用分为模型、视图和控制器三部分。

  模型层采用框架自带的数据模板组件,完成数据的初始化、存储和操作。视图层采用WeUI和WuxUI组件库,进行前端开发和UI设计。控制器层采用小程序框架提供的生命周期和事件处理机制,保证应用的用户交互和功能流程。

  通过这种分层架构,乌伊岭H5小程序实现了前后端分离,提高了代码的可维护性、可扩展性和可复用性。

  2. 乌伊岭H5小程序的运行环境

  乌伊岭H5小程序采用微信开发者工具进行开发和调试,同时支持微信、支付宝等多个平台的发布和推广。

  微信开发者工具提供了调试、模拟器、预览和发布等丰富的功能,方便开发者进行本地调试和云端测试。乌伊岭H5小程序在微信开发者工具上进行本地调试和模拟器测试,通过上传到微信公众号后,进行真机测试和发布。

  3. 乌伊岭H5小程序的调试与测试

  乌伊岭H5小程序采用了良好的调试和测试机制,确保程序的稳定性和可靠性。开发过程中,利用微信开发者工具自带的调试功能,可以很方便地通过打断点、监控变量、调用函数等方式进行调试。

  针对用户提交的异常问题,开发者可以通过微信公众平台提供的错误日志和数据实时监控工具,进行问题排查和数据分析。 另外,还可以利用第三方错误监控工具对程序进行监控和预警,及时发现和处理潜在风险。

  4. 乌伊岭H5小程序的性能优化

  乌伊岭H5小程序为了提高用户体验和性能,采用了多种优化方案。其中包括:

  (1)代码压缩和减少请求次数:采用压缩和合并CSS、JS、图片等资源来减少请求次数和传输时延;

  (2)动态加载和预处理:按需加载和缓存资源,提高程序启动和响应速度;

  (3)滚动性能优化:采用长列表滚动、虚拟滚动、懒加载等技术,提高列表渲染和滚动的性能;

  (4)组件复用和提前渲染:采用组件化开发和视图缓存技术,提高页面渲染和资源利用率。

  5. 结尾段落

  以上就是乌伊岭H5小程序的高级研发技术之路。通过对技术架构、运行环境、调试测试和性能优化等方面的探讨,我们可以看到,技术上的不断实践和创新才能推动应用的不断提高和突破。希望本文能够对大家了解小程序开发和推广提供一些参考和借鉴。

  • 原标题:探秘乌伊岭H5小程序高级研发的技术之路

  • 本文链接:https:////zxzx/125012.html

  • 本文由深圳飞扬众网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与飞扬众网联系删除。
  • 微信二维码

    CTAPP999

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:166-2096-5058


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部